It is with a heavy heart that the family of Aimé Arthur Dupuis announces his passing at the Maison McCulloch Hospice on Tuesday, July 17th, 2018 at the age of 68.
Aimé will be forever remembered by his wife and best friend of 46 years Janet Dupuis (nee Sagodore) and their two wonderful daughters Jennifer Branconnier (husband Roger) and Karen Courvoisier (husband Daniel). Aimé will always lovingly be remembered by his three grandchildren, beautiful and smart granddaughter Sophie, his athletic and kind-hearted grandson Samuel and his caring and thoughtful grandson Nathan. Predeceased by his father Hector and his mother Lilette Dupuis. He will be sadly missed by his brothers Roger (Pauline), Danny (Suzanne), Paul (Sue), Walter (Sharlene), sisters Joanne Houle (Richard) and Monique Mearinie (John), sisters-in-law Patricia McLean (Michael) and Catherine Rochon (Jacques). Aimé will be sadly missed by many nieces, nephews and their families and he will be remembered by his many friends in Sudbury and the Snowbirds in Okeechobee, Florida.
“He was once asked what else he would have liked to have done in his life. He answered, I did everything that I wanted to do.”
